Weiner was a dog at the camp where I work during the summer. He was 15 years old last year, and had only made the quarter-mile trek down to camp a few times and couldn't make it back up on his own. Most of us doubted he could make it through another winter. He lived for the summers spent at camp interacting with the kids and we thought that his inability to participate much last summer would be the final nail in the coffin.
Well, I was down there for a training last weekend, and the camp director invited us to his house for dessert with his family. As we got out of the car, there was Weiner making his way from behind the house. You could just see it in his eyes that he knew camp was just around the corner. Not only was his tail wagging but his entire back end was too. He looked almost like a different dog. He went through 3 rounds of antibiotics over the winter and was moving around better than he had since I began working there three years ago. I was glad to see that this living legend that has brightened the day of over 20,000 campers over the years is going to be a part of the place he loves so much for at least one more summer.
